Well, nothing good was going to happen with Ziady still in place. He was the former President's lackey - he was the guy in charge of getting rid of Keeler (apparently the former President was the one behind running Keeler out of Newark - he didn't want the head coach to have control over his own coaching staff among other things he didn't like about football). Since the former President left, it was just a matter of time.
As for UD, others are right, it's really the BOT that calls the shots. There's apparently a new chairman there, though, and hopefully with the new President starting in July there could be some new blood. Problem is, though, that the program is never going to bring back the fans at the FCS level. UD could easily be good again on the field in FCS, but they won't come close to filling the stadium again. Ran off too many lifelong fans, and their families, with bad decisions that had nothing to do with the product on the field. If UD does get revitalized, it will be for the move up to FBS.
